Samsung Galaxy S5 Gets Early Reveal in Video

Samsung is preparing to launch the Galaxy S5 at their Unpacked 5 event tonight here in Barcelona. While we are just 16 hours away from the event, someone might have just “accidentally” revealed the device in an instagram video. The video, which has since been taken down, appears to be taken on location during the preparation of today’s Samsung Unpacked 5 event.

The video focuses on the new Samsung Gear 2 Neo smart watch but in the background we can see three similar looking but unfamiliar devices in three different colours — they could very well be the Galaxy S5.

A closer look revealed a bigger LED flash below the camera which matches the earlier Galaxy S5 casing and design reference render. From the video, it appears that the Galaxy S5 could be coming in 3 colours — White, Black and Gold — and it will still retain a removable back cover, that to our eyes, still look plastic.

It was also speculated that the Galaxy S5 will come in two versions, one being a more premium model with higher specs and the other being a cheaper base model. We believe the version seen in the video is the base model.
